- Child born during international flight to US sparks heated debate about citizenship, legal identity
A woman gave birth midair on a flight from Kingston, Jamaica, to New York, sparking debate over the baby's U.S. citizenship. Legal experts and online commenters discussed whether birth in U.S. airspace qualifies for birthright citizenship, with some criticizing the situation as a legal loophole.
